'DOOMED!' - Gyokeres splits with girlfriend to complete Arsenal move
Viktor Gyokeres’ transfer to Arsenal is set to be made official this weekend, and the Sporting CP striker is so serious about his move to the Premier League, he is ready to split with girlfriend Ines Aguiar over the switch.
Gyokeres is set to complete a deal worth a total of €80 million to move to the North London side, ending a saga that has stretched back months.
Now that he is finally going to be an Arsenal player, the Sweden international forward wants absolutely no distractions – even if that means breaking up with his partner.
The Portuguese media have been fascinated by his relationship with actress Aguiar, which became public last season.
There has been no official breakup between the pair, yet after Aguiar was spotted on holiday alone, it was claimed that the couple had already gone their separate ways.
Flash claims that Aguiar is fighting to restore the relationship, but faces an uphill task to do so.
“The Swedish striker spent his holidays alone, making it clear that on his list of priorities, there is room for almost everything except love, which seems doomed,” it reports.
“The romance has cooled and there will be no great future for a relationship that worked when Gyokeres’ reality was Sporting CP and Portugal.”
Gyokeres, it has been suggested, never wanted to commit to a strong relationship with Aguiar as he rarely posted images with her on his social channels – something he was happy to do with his previous partner Amanda Nilden.
Gyokeres ready to get down to business
Now the Swede is ready to take another big step in his life, with the move to Arsenal set to be completed imminently.
Manager Mikel Arteta will be pleased with the player’s focus on football, and the Gunners boss is ready to rush his new recruit into action.
A hot date has been arranged for Thursday as he prepares to make his Arsenal debut against Tottenham Hotspur.
